Přizpůsobení funkce SharePointu
Funkce SharePointu můžete vytvářet a přizpůsobovat pomocí Návrháře funkcí v sadě Visual Studio. Můžete například nastavit obor funkce a přidat další funkce jako závislosti. Návrhář funkcí se ve výchozím nastavení otevře, když přidáte novou funkci v Průzkumník řešení nebo v Průzkumníku balíčků služby SharePoint.
Otevření Návrháře funkcí
Položky projektu SharePointu můžete do funkce přidat nebo odebrat pomocí Návrháře funkcí.
Otevření Návrháře funkcí
V Průzkumník řešení rozbalte položku Funkce.
Poklikejte na položku Feature1 nebo otevřete místní nabídku pro položku Feature1 a pak zvolte Návrhář zobrazení.
Zobrazení zabaleného souboru manifestu
Pomocí Návrháře funkcí můžete upravit a vygenerovat soubor zabaleného manifestu pro funkci (feature.xml). Pak můžete zobrazit kód XML pro tento soubor v sadě Visual Studio.
Zobrazení zabaleného souboru manifestu
- V Návrháři funkcí zvolte kartu Manifest.
Zobrazení zabaleného souboru manifestu pomocí Průzkumník řešení
V Průzkumník řešení zvolte ikonu Zobrazit všechny soubory.
Rozbalte funkce, rozbalte FeatureName, rozbalte FeatureName.feature a pak otevřete <FeatureName>. Soubor Template.xml .
Poznámka:
Když otevřete soubor XML manifestu šablony funkce, soubory se automaticky ověří a upozornění, která se zobrazí v okně Seznam chyb, se dají ignorovat.
Změna šablony manifestu
Kód XML pro soubor manifestu funkce můžete změnit v editoru XML sady Visual Studio nebo v podokně Šablony manifestu. Všechny změny kódu XML se sloučí do souboru zabaleného manifestu pro funkci. Můžete například chtít změnit šablonu manifestu tak, aby přizpůsobila vlastnost Funkce.
Změna šablony manifestu pomocí editoru XML
V Návrháři funkcí zvolte kartu Manifest, rozbalte uzel Upravit možnosti a pak zvolte odkaz Otevřít v editoru XML.
Změny xml se sloučí do zabaleného souboru manifestu.
Změna šablony manifestu pomocí podokna Šablona manifestu
V Návrháři funkcí zvolte kartu Manifest, rozbalte uzel Upravit možnosti a potom změňte XML, který se zobrazí v podokně Šablony manifestu.
Změny xml se zobrazí v podokně Náhled balíčku manifestu .
Přepsání souboru zabaleného manifestu
Návrhář funkcí můžete zakázat a vytvořit soubor feature.xml ručně. Při prvním provedení tohoto postupu se aktuální nastavení v Návrháři funkcí uloží do souboru XML šablony funkce. Pak můžete kód XML upravit nebo přepsat.
Poznámka:
Pokud v souboru XML přidáte nebo odeberete položky projektu SharePointu, když je návrhář funkcí zakázaný, tyto položky projektu nejsou zabalené.
Přepsání zabaleného souboru manifestu zakázáním návrháře
V Návrháři funkcí zvolte kartu Manifest.
Rozbalte uzel Upravit možnosti, zvolte vygenerovaný kód XML a upravte manifest v odkazu editoru XML a pak zvolte tlačítko Ano.
Šablona se aktualizuje pomocí aktuálního zabaleného souboru manifestu.
Povolení Návrháře funkcí
Návrhář funkcí můžete znovu povolit a přizpůsobit soubor feature.xml .
Opětovné povolení návrháře
V Návrháři funkcí zvolte úpravy manifestu Zahodit a znovu povolte odkaz návrháře a pak zvolte tlačítko Ano.
Šablona se aktualizuje původním textem a všechny změny XML se ztratí.